Stealth Camping is when you camp off-trail at an unprepared, virgin campsite. At a minimum, we are likely to move sticks and rocks from the areas we want to lay on the ground; we will compress the ground that we sit, lie, or walk on, and we will probably create noticeable paths between out cooking and shelter area. Heres some other considerations: 1) choose a site that has little to no vegetation, such as a really shady area w/less than 10% ground vegetation cover, 2) pick a site that is at least 100-200 ft from the A.T. that others are unlikely to ever find and reuse, 3) dont alter the site in any way, 4) hammocks are great for this but if you use a tent or tarp fluff up the leaves when you leave and throw a few branches around it to discourage its future use, 5) dont build a campfire on these sites, and 6) this is best done with a small number of people and only for one night. If youve ever come across a Stealth Campsite thats littered with trash, shows evidence of a big fire and a crudely constructed fire ring, broken tree limbs that have been used as firewood, initials carved in trees, rope burns on trees, herd paths through virgin forest, or campsites surrounded by flattened vegetation, its easy to adopt this point of view. Well replace the sticks and rocks we removed from our sleeping areas and refluff the forest duff we slept or stepped on. any trailhead Camping regulations vary widely because the Appalachian Trail corridor consists of a patchwork ribbon of many different types of lands managed by more than 75 different agencies. Camping is permitted at non-designated sites in the White Mountain National Forest: Two hundred feet (80 paces) away from trails and water sources, 1/4 mile beyond trailheads, huts, shelters, campgrounds, day use sites, and developed tent sites, In areas where the trees are taller than 8 feet (ie.
